2007 Sauternes Semillon, Sauvignon Blanc

Barton & Guestier Sauternes is a delightful white wine from the famed Sauternes region, showcasing the incredible potential of the Semillon and Sauvignon Blanc varietals. This vintage celebrates a beautifully balanced profile characterized by a full-bodied structure that envelops the palate with its richness. Its acidity is vibrant and refreshing, providing a mouthwatering brightness that lifts the wine, making it a remarkable companion to a variety of desserts. The fruit intensity is pronounced, with notes of luscious stone fruit and honey that exuberantly dance on the tongue. As a sweet wine, it elegantly maintains dryness, enhancing its food-friendly qualities and making it quite enjoyable on its own or paired with desserts. This Sauternes is a testament to the region’s unique terroir and the artistry of winemaking, inviting you to savor every sip.
